Lot no. 424
Joseph Martin (1774-1829)
Large Jacquot jug
In glazed earthenware with yellow enamel and orange-brown pastillage decoration, in the form of a general (or probably Louis XVIII), wearing epaulettes, decorations and buttons on his uniform, sitting on a barrel, a goblet, a snuffbox and a bottle on his lap. Handle with pastillage decoration. Incised handwritten signature "Etrepigney 18..", "Martin Joseph".
Jura, first third of the 19th century
H. 30.5 cm - L. 18 cm
Restorations (feet, shoulder pads, bottle)
Note: many of the artist's works can be seen at the eponymous museum in Etrepigney.
